 Article Headline: SOLAR AT NIGHT
 Abstract: A 100 MW solar plant, which has been developed near the town of Pofadder, in the Northern Cape, has officially been inaugurated. Known as KaXu Solar One, the thermal electricity power plant incorporate a storage system that enables it to produce electricity 2.5 hours after sunset, or before dawn. The R8-billion parabolic-trough facility is 3 km long, a kilometre wide and contains 1 200 collectors, as well as molten-salt energy-storage system
